Abstract
L’invention concerne un module de chauffage et de refroidissement de l'eau basé sur un système aérothermique et la microaccumulation, du type contenant une pompe à chaleur à (17), une unité extérieure de machine aérothermique (1), un commutateur de débit (13), des pompes d’impulsion du circuit de chauffage/refroidissement à sens unique (15) et de retour (16), une électrovanne (8), une sonde de température extérieure (7), une sonde de mesure de la température de l’eau chaude (6), un fluxostat (14), un module de production d’eau chaude (échangeur de chaleur) (3) un buffer (réservoir de stockage), avec la distribution de température stratifiée (4), un séparateur hydraulique (5), une vanne anti-retour (à trois voies) (10), une vanne d’utilisation (à trois voies) (11), utilisant une chaudière (2), une vanne à deux voies (8}, une vanne mélangeure (à trois voies) (12).The invention relates to a water heating and cooling module based on an aerothermal system and microaccumulation, of the type containing a heat pump (17), an outdoor unit of an aerothermal machine (1), a flow switch. (13), one-way (15) and return (16) heating / cooling circuit impulse pumps, a solenoid valve (8), an outside temperature sensor (7), a temperature measurement sensor hot water (6), a flow switch (14), a hot water production module (heat exchanger) (3) a buffer (storage tank), with stratified temperature distribution (4), a hydraulic separator (5), a non-return valve (three-way) (10), an operating valve (three-way) (11), using a boiler (2), a two-way valve (8}, a mixing valve (three-way) (12).
